Chocolate Chunk Oat Cookies

Chewy, hearty, and loaded with irresistible chocolate chunks, these Chocolate Chunk Oat Cookies are the ultimate treat for any cookie lover. Featuring a delightful blend of rich, buttery sweetness from two types of sugar, the comforting texture of old-fashioned rolled oats, and the decadence of melty chocolate in every bite, these cookies strike the perfect balance between indulgence and heartiness. Ready in just 27 minutes, they’re made with pantry staples and are easy enough for bakers of all levels. Whether enjoyed fresh out of the oven with a glass of milk or saved for a sweet snack during the week, these cookies are a crowd-pleasing favorite that you won’t be able to resist. Perfect for dessert, lunch boxes, or a cozy afternoon treat!

Image of Chocolate Chunk Oat Cookies
Prep Time:15 mins
Cook Time:12 mins
Total Time:27 mins
Servings: 24

Ingredients

  • 115 grams unsalted butter
  • 100 grams granulated sugar
  • 150 grams light brown sugar
  • 1 large egg
  • 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
  • 125 grams all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• 0.5 teaspoon salt
  • 150 grams old-fashioned rolled oats
  • 200 grams chocolate chunks
  • 0 milk (optional, for serving)

Directions

Step 1

Preheat your oven to 175°C (350°F) and line two baking sheets with parchment paper.

Step 2

In a large bowl, use a hand or stand mixer to cream the unsalted butter, granulated sugar, and light brown sugar together until light and fluffy, about 2-3 minutes.

Step 3

Beat in the egg and vanilla extract until well combined.

Step 4

In a separate medium b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king soda, and salt.

Step 5

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, mixing until just combined.

Step 6

Fold in the rolled oats and chocolate chunks using a spatula or wooden spoon.

Step 7

Scoop tablespoon-sized portions of the dough and place them on the prepared baking sheets, spacing them about 2 inches apart.

Step 8

Bake in the preheated oven for 10-12 minutes, or until the edges are lightly golden but the centers still look slightly underdone.

Step 9

Remove from the oven and let the cookies cool on the baking sheet for 5 min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.

Step 10

Serve the cookies with milk (optional) or store them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to one week.
